WebDescription. The serdes.CTLE System object™ applies a linear peaking filter to equalize a sample-by-sample input signal or to analytically process an impulse response vector input signal. The equalization process reduces distortions resulting from lossy channels. The filter is a real one-zero two-pole (1z/2p) filter, unless you define the gain-pole-zero (GPZ) matrix. Continuous Time Linear Equalizers (CTLEs) for PCIe3 and PCIe4

WebJul 1, 2016 · A CTLE is a high pass filter employed in the receiver and is used to boost the high frequency components of the signal to compensate for the channel loss [9]. To overcome this deficit, inductive loads are used, replacing the resistive load, as shown in Fig. 4 b. The addition of inductive load impacts in time and frequency domains. In the frequency domain, it increases the bandwidth of the CTLE by inductive peaking.

Internally, the CTLE is designed to minimize any random jitter (RJ) additions to the high-speed signal. Externally, it is impossible for the CTLE gain to discrim-inate between signal and system noise.
